Enerjisa Enerji Continues to Raise Awareness of Children with “I Protect My Energy”

Enerjisa Enerji continues to raise awareness of children on energy efficiency and conservation in the new season with I Protect My Energy, the globally recognized social responsibility project which has been ongoing since 2010. Having gathered over 300,000 students in 750 schools in 15 provinces so far, Enerjisa Enerji will keep raising awareness of children for a better future with the theater play, ‘May the Stars Not Be Offended’, Energy Protectors training and the story contest in the 14th year of the project.

The results of the survey regarding the awareness of children on energy conservation, which was conducted by Enerjisa Enerji in collaboration with an independent survey company, are interesting. According to a survey conducted with 1000 parents with children (ages 7-13) nationwide, 54 percent of the children were observed to have limited awareness on energy saving. While saving water is the most sensitive issue for children among saving habits, 8 out of 10 children raise awareness on the issue at schools.

Energy conservation awareness of children limited

The findings of the survey, which was conducted by Enerjisa Enerji in collaboration with an independent survey company to measure the awareness of children (ages 7-10) in Turkey on energy conservation, revealed that kids are mostly aware of protecting the environment by 62 percent. While 5 out of 10 children were observed to have limited information on energy conservation, kids are not very much aware of global warming nor carbon footprint. Whilst 8 percent of children are aware of carbon footprint, 35 percent have no knowledge of global warming.

Water: the energy resource that children are mainly aware of

Children are mainly aware of water as the energy resource by 63 percent, while the awareness on keeping the water not running while not using was revealed to be the most sensitive measure taken by children with 67 percent. While 6 out of every 10 children turn the electricity off if not needed, 53 percent of the kids contribute to recycling.

Families and schools, the main information providers

While almost all of the interviewed parents care about their children raising awareness on energy conservation, families and schools prevail in providing children with information on energy conservation and saving. The ratio of children who acquire information from online and mobile applications to have knowledge about issues such as global warming and climate change is also quite high. While 7 out of 10 children were stated to get support from an information source such as books or education, the platforms where children spend time can also be used as a source of information.
